Abstract
An internal combustion engine includes an intake air compressor system and is fluidly coupled to an exhaust aftertreatment system having a particulate filter. A method for operating the internal combustion engine includes determining a total engine-out soot generation based upon a summation of a steady-state engine-out soot generation rate and an engine-out soot generation rate correction. The engine-out soot generation rate correction is either zero when the intake air compressor system is closed-loop controlled or a rate based upon a deviation between an actual boost pressure and an expected boost pressure from the intake air compressor system. The particulate filter is regenerated when the total engine-out soot generation exceeds a predetermined threshold.
